Understanding Very first Aid

First help describes the prompt care supplied to a private struggling with a minor or serious disease or injury until specialist clinical help shows up. Understanding standard emergency treatment principles can make a substantial difference in emergency situation situations.

Key Elements of First Aid

Assessment: The capability to analyze a situation rapidly can aid figure out the proper activities needed. Stabilization: Recognizing just how to support a harmed person avoids more harm. Communication: Successfully interacting with emergency situation solutions is essential for prompt assistance.

The Significance of CPR

CPR is a life-saving technique used in emergency situations when someone's heartbeat or breathing has actually quit. It involves breast compressions and rescue breaths to keep blood circulation and oxygenation up until specialist assistance arrives.

How mouth-to-mouth resuscitation Works

    Chest Compressions: These aid distribute blood throughout the body. Rescue Breaths: These provide oxygen to the lungs.

First Help Surges vs. Mouth-to-mouth Resuscitation Courses: What's the Difference?

While both sorts of programs are essential, they concentrate on different skill sets.

First Aid Courses

These courses cover a wide range of topics past just cardiac emergency situations, consisting of:

    Wound care Burns Choking

CPR Courses

CPR programs especially focus on strategies associated with cardiac arrest circumstances, stressing:

    Adult CPR Child/ infant resuscitation Use of an Automated External Defibrillator (AED)

FAQ Section

First Aid Course Sydney CBD What is included in a common first aid course?
    A common first aid course includes direction on evaluating injuries, treating injuries, handling burns, dealing with choking incidents, and executing mouth-to-mouth resuscitation if necessary.
How long does it take to complete a CPR course?
    Most mouth-to-mouth resuscitation training courses last between 4-- 6 hours relying on whether it's fundamental or advanced training.
Is qualification needed for office emergency treatment providers?
    While not always legally mandated, having actually certified employee can significantly improve office security standards.
Can I restore my emergency treatment certificate online?
    Many recognized organizations offer on-line renewal choices for emergency treatment certificates which include evaluations using video conferencing.
Are there particular markets where emergency treatment training is mandatory?
    Yes, markets such as building, healthcare, education and learning, and manufacturing typically have regulatory requirements necessitating qualified personnel on site.
How typically needs to employees undergo refresher course courses?
    It's recommended that employees take part in refresher courses every 2 years or quicker if there are considerable adjustments in treatments or regulations.
